Re: Obtaining older (minor) versions?
HI lluttrell, welcome to the forums.
Thanks for sharing the case number, and sorry to hear about the challenges.
I see the case was opened as a Free case which receives "best-effort" support; I strongly recommend obtain an Evaluation License from my.veeam.com and re-open the case with an Evaluation license as that will receive Evaluation Support instead of best-effort.
Older versions can be obtained through Support, however, without a review of the debug logs I think it's a bit premature to call it a bug -- I see that others reported similar issues, but an authentication error is something that should be investigated to understand the actual root cause. Not saying it's not an issue on recovery media, more saying "not enough information" at the moment.
I repeat the recommendation to obtain an Evaluation license for your evaluation period and reopen the case with Evaluation Support.
